**Minutes — Management Meeting, Harvell Trading Co.**

Present: R. Okafor (chair), L. Brandt, T. Mewson. The committee reviewed the lease renegotiation for the Dunmere Crossing premises. Brandt reported the landlord, Quillstone Properties, has proposed a five-year term with a stepped rent increase. Mewson noted comparable sites in Dunmere remain cheaper per square metre. All agreed terms must be settled before the current lease lapses. Branch managers should hold expansion assumptions pending the outcome below.

internal memo for yahaf-hawif: The finance team signed off on a budget of $59.9 million for Project Rusax.

## Data-Centre Cage Visits — Facilities Desk

Contractors visiting the Oakhaven cage must be logged in the day sheet and issued a visitor lanyard before escort. The duty engineer confirms the works order. Cage gate readers accept visitor passes only when paired with the daily code, which is as follows.

turnstile pass: bdg-QZV-3

Welcome to the Corella dedup team. Our matcher collapses duplicate customer records nightly using fuzzy name and postal comparisons, then writes survivor IDs back to the Hallin store. Review PRs against the match-threshold config carefully: lowering it below 0.82 has historically merged unrelated households in the Vexbury dataset. Local runs need the stage replica, which requires an authenticated tunnel. Copy env.sample to .env, set your region to stage-2, and then add the replica access line shown below.

vault entry, yahif-yajep: COURIER_KEY29=b802bdf8034096b65a51c6ba5abe2

Break-glass access — Norwind load balancer tier. If health checks fail on all backends and on-call is unreachable, use the break-glass account on the standby bastion to bypass the checker and pin traffic to node-3. Log every action in the incident channel. The break-glass account unlocks with the recovery passphrase below.

strongbox words: zorath-holmir